Latest Patents
One of Can Li's latest inventions, titled “Methods and systems for an analog cam with fuzzy search,” addresses the implementation of an analog content addressable memory (analog CAM). This invention is particularly structured to allow variance in search operations, enabling the CAM to locate approximate matches within a defined range. The circuitry includes advanced features that utilize search-variance parameters to dynamically adjust the restrictiveness of searches, making it exceptionally efficient for complex applications.
Another groundbreaking patent titled “Analog error detection and correction in analog in-memory crossbars” introduces an analog error correction circuit employing an analog error correction code. This circuit showcases a crossbar array of memristors that plays a crucial role in correcting computation errors during matrix operations. The innovative design allows for single-cycle error detection and provides a sophisticated method for identifying and correcting errors, substantially improving the reliability of analog computations.
